Question 899075: A cistern normally filled in 8 hours, takes 2 hours longer due to a leak. If the cistern is full the leak shall empty it in ?

Let x represent time leak would take to drain pool
|Multiplying thru by 40x so as all denominators = 1
5x - 40 = 4x
x = 40hrs, time leak would take to drain pool
